Nasal allergies and sinus infections are among the most common health issues affecting children, especially in their early years. These conditions can directly impact a child’s sleep, focus, and daily activity—making early diagnosis and continuous follow-up essential. Dr. Mohamed El-Masry emphasizes that early detection of allergy or sinusitis symptoms in children can prevent complications and reduce long-term medication use. Warning signs parents should watch for include persistent nasal congestion, nighttime coughing, frequent sneezing, mouth breathing, and recurring nasal discharge.
According to Dr. Mohamed El-Masry, two main types of cases are frequently seen in his clinic:
Seasonal or chronic allergic rhinitis: Often triggered by environmental factors and seen more commonly during spring.
Recurrent sinusitis: Usually caused by enlarged adenoids or poor ventilation in the nasal passages.
Dr. Mohamed El-Masry explains that treatment plans depend on the severity and duration of the symptoms, and may include:
Nasal sprays and antihistamines: For daily symptom control.
Saline nasal rinses: Especially useful for younger children.
Nasal and sinus endoscopy: To evaluate the condition thoroughly and determine the need for additional intervention.
Surgical intervention when needed: Such as adenoid removal or sinus drainage in chronic cases.
Dr. Mohamed El-Masry stresses that the family’s role is critical in observing and monitoring the child’s symptoms. Treatment is not limited to medication; avoiding triggers like dust, smoke, and strong perfumes is just as important. He advises consulting a specialist if symptoms persist for more than 10 days without improvement.
